No blanket pardons for Jan. 6 rioters, says Hutchinson.

TL;DR Summary
Republican presidential candidate Asa Hutchinson has promised not to issue "blanket pardons" to those convicted in connection with the Jan. 6 attack on the U.S. Capitol if he is elected president. Hutchinson's stance contrasts with those of the two front-runners in the 2024 GOP presidential primary, former President Donald Trump and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is, who have both said they would consider pardons for the rioters. Hutchinson has emerged as a key Republican voice refuting Trump's false claims of election fraud and has called on Trump to drop out of the 2024 race.
